Explain the "air-sea gas exchange" and what gases are involved.

Biology
1 answer:
Anton [14]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Air-sea exchange is a physio-chemical process and is important for the cycling of gases such as carbon dioxide, methane, nitrous oxide, dimethylsulfide and ammonia

What type of cycle is the water cycle grouped as
geniusboy [140]

Answer:

hydrologic cycle

Explanation:

Water cycle. Water cycle, also called hydrologic cycle, cycle that involves the continuous circulation of water in the Earth-atmosphere system. Of the many processes involved in the water cycle, the most important are evaporation, transpiration, condensation, precipitation, and runoff.
